In preparation for THIS tour we had a lot of the cooling system renewed:

Radiator
Radiator cap
Expansion tank cap (so you know it blows at the right pressure)
Fan switch (crucial for switching the fans on at the right time)
Thermostat
Water pump
Most of the rubber hoses, the ones that get properly hot anyway
Steel heater pipe, driver's side
Autobox supply & return pipes, driver's side
Steel heater pipe over top of gearbox

While the system is down you may as well do the lot. All the above were done with genuine Mazda parts, some but not all the hoses in the club shop are pukka Mazda ones :wink:
